Congress - Wikipedia
https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Congress
WebA congress is a formal meeting of the representatives of different countries, constituent states, organizations, trade unions, political parties, or other groups. [1] . The term originated in Late Middle English to denote an encounter (meeting of adversaries) during battle, from the Latin congressus. [2] Political congresses.

Congress of the United States | History, Powers & Structure
https://www.britannica.com/topic/Congress-of-the-United-States
Web3 days ago · Congress of the United States, the legislature of the United States of America, established under the Constitution of 1789 and separated structurally from the executive and judicial branches of government. It consists of two houses: the Senate, in which each state, regardless of its size, is.
